Key differences

ZTOP is a fixed income ETF, while ISSB is an alternative ETF. ZTOP charges 0.39% a year and ISSB 1.14%.

  • ZTOP is a fixed income fund, while ISSB is an alternative fund. They carry different risk/return profiles.
  • ZTOP follows a index tracking strategy; ISSB uses option income.
  • ZTOP costs 0.75% less per year.
  • ZTOP is much larger than ISSB. Larger funds are usually more liquid and less likely to close.
